Making Sense of CPM vs CPC

Last but certainly not least: understanding CPM versus CPC—this one often trips creators up but stick around because grasping this concept puts power back in your hands as a creator looking forward towards earning potential via advertising campaigns.

  • ‘CPM’ stands for ‘cost per mille’, essentially what advertisers will shell out for every thousand impressions (views) of their advertisement within YOUR video content;
  • ‘CPC’ means ‘cost per click,’ referring specifically to price tags attached each time somebody clicks rather than simply views an ad during THEIR visit watching YOUR awesome sauce creations.

The Effect of Geographic Location on View Counts and Revenue

Buckle up because we’re taking a trip around the world—virtually speaking. Your viewer’s geographic location can make or break the bank when it comes down to money made from youtube videos. Why does this matter? Because advertisers target audiences based on region-specific interests and purchasing power which affects CPM (cost per thousand impressions) rates directly linked with what you earn.

In other words, eyeballs from some countries are worth more than others due to higher advertiser demand and spending capabilities within those markets.

The Basics of Payment Thresholds

First off, let’s talk brass tacks about what “payment threshold” really means. In the world of YouTube earnings, this is the minimum amount you need in your AdSense account before Google initiates a payout. Currently, that magic number sits at $100.

If your videos are drawing crowds and ads are flashing across screens worldwide, each view inches you closer to crossing that threshold line where money flows from pixels to pockets. It’s all about getting enough eyeballs on those video ads—after all, more views mean more ad revenue potential for every creator out there.

But don’t forget: actual earnings depend on factors like which ads work best for your content and how engaged people watch them—the estimated CTR based calculation gives an idea but isn’t set in stone because viewer behavior keeps changing just like fashion trends.

Payout Frequency Explained

You’ve crossed the $100 mark? Congrats. Now get ready for payday—it comes around once monthly through AdSense after reaching or surpassing the payment threshold by the end of any given month. Keep in mind though; these payments follow net-30 terms—which basically means if you meet the threshold by January’s end, expect February to greet you with some extra greenery.
